The DNA Detectives
Linden Harris
7 episodes
4 months ago
What is DNA? How is it used? Why does it matter? Dr Mandy Hartley and real life DNA detective, Annabelle Hartley, talk to top scientists who work with DNA every day. It's aimed at kids but the grown-ups might learn a thing or two as well.

DNA: Curing disease
We’re beginning to understand how using DNA can cure life-threatening diseases. Dr Matt Johnson tells us about one – neonatal diabetes – and how his work is transforming the lives of babies and children.
